(correct spelling) is a comedy-drama that captures the hilarious and often chaotic life of four freshers in an engineering college hostel. It resonated deeply with Indian audiences because of its relatable characters, sharp writing, and authentic portrayal of hostel culture.

The technical specifications that follow—specifically "720p"—reveal the socioeconomic reality of the downloader. In a world pushing toward 4K and 8K resolution, "720p" acts as a compromise. It is the "best" option for many not because it offers the highest fidelity, but because it offers the highest practicality. For students, travelers, or those with limited bandwidth and data caps, 720p is the gold standard of efficiency: clear enough to enjoy on a laptop screen, yet small enough to download quickly. The claim of "best" in the subject line is therefore subjective; it is not an artistic judgment of the show’s quality, but a technical judgment of its value-to-size ratio.
